FOR OUR PET FRIENDLY VISITORS:
PETS MUST BE APPROVED BY MANAGEMENT PRIOR TO RESERVATION. We reserve the right to refuse any pet at any time. We would like for you and your family (including the four-legged members) to have the best vacation ever, and appreciate your willingness to abide by these guidelines.
- We only accept dogs; no cats allowed. We only accept 2 pets per reservation.
- We charge a $70.00 per stay per pet fee, which is not refundable.
- Your dog must be on a flea maintenance program. (Like Frontline, Advantage, etc.)
- Your dog must be crated while left in the cabin alone.
- Your dog must not get on our furniture. If we find pet hair on our furniture upon your departure, you will be charged $10.00 per each quilt/comforter/sofa that must be cleaned to remove dog hair.
- If your dog damages our vacation home in any way (e.g., urine on the carpet/floor, chewed furniture/walls/doors or molding), you will be held responsible for the damage repair costs.
- Your dog must be leashed when outside of the cabin. This is for the safety of your dog, as there may be other animals in the area that could harm your beloved pet.

Common Concerns:
*Road Conditions: Some of our cabins are on steep, narrow, curvy, mountain roads. If you are concerned about road conditions to get to a cabin, please feel free to ask us! None of our cabins requires a 4-wheel drive under normal weather conditions, but some do in inclement weather.
*TV & WiFi: We do have TVs and WiFi in most of our cabins. There are times when heavy cloud cover, weather systems, mountains, or trees will cause problems with the signals. We always want our guests to have the comforts they want on vacation, but there are times we cannot control this problem.
*Pests & Wildlife: Here in the Smoky Mountains, we have lots of native bugs and wildlife. All of our cabins are treated for pests, but there are times you will find bugs or even have trouble with bugs. Please let us know if they are causing trouble; we will handle it as quickly and efficiently as possible. Please never feed, taunt, or approach any wildlife. This is their home, and we are the visitors.
